DURANT, Okla. – Despite strong starts in each set, Southeastern saw Arkansas-Fort Smith use mid-set runs to pull away with a 3-0 win on Tuesday evening in Bloomer Sullivan Gymnasium.
SE dropped the first set 25-15, set two 25-19 and set three 25-15, falling to 2-23 overall on the season.
The Savage Storm will be back on the court for the third of its three-match home stand to host rival East Central on Oct. 25 at 7 p.m. As part of the volleyball team's Dig Pink efforts to raise money and awareness for breast cancer, fans are encouraged to wear pink to the match.
For the second time this season,
Madelynne Cera fell one kill shy of a triple-double, finishing the match with nine kills, 10 assists and 10 digs. Her nine kills led the Storm offense, while her 10 assists matched the team best.
Emily Gentle added eight kills and
Natasha Smith turned in four.
Cera and
Marina Dias each turned in 10 assists in the match and each tallied double-doubles. Dias turned in 11 digs in the effort which matched the team-high, while Cera's 10 digs gave her a double-double.
Taylor Benner matched Dias with 11 digs to lead the Storm on the back row, while
Jasmine Everage added a pair of blocks to lead the way at the net.
